TECH NEWS RADIO #285 | 060502 | Cisco Unified Call Manager Express, VoIP, PBX, Cisco IOS, Voice Mail
If you are interested in deploying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) to a branch or remote office, then this podcast might give you a head start in determining a product to evaluate.
Technology and links mentioned in this podcast include:
- Cisco Unified Call Manager Express (CME) 4.0
- Session Initiation Protocol (SIP)
- POTS
- PBX
- VPN tunnel
- video-conferencing
- Cisco IOS 12.4 (4)
- Cisco Unity Express (CUE) 2.3 voice mail services
- Cisco Quick Configuration Tool 2.0
- Survivable Remote Site Telephony
- IMAP
And as in the podcast the costs for this setup was:
- Cisco 2801 with 24-user CCME Bundle ($3095)
- Unity Express SCUE-12-VM option ($2995)
